Starting a website development project is an exciting milestone for any business, but proper preparation can mean the difference between a smooth, successful launch and a frustrating experience filled with delays and cost overruns. Whether you’re building your first business website or upgrading an existing one, taking the time to prepare properly will help ensure your project delivers the results you need.
In this guide, we’ll walk you through the essential steps to prepare your business before embarking on a website development project.
Define Your Goals and Objectives
Before any code is written or design created, you need crystal-clear answers to some fundamental questions: What do you want your website to achieve? Are you looking to generate leads, sell products online, showcase your portfolio, or provide customer support?
Your website’s purpose will directly influence every decision throughout the development process, from design choices to functionality requirements. Take time to document specific, measurable goals. Instead of saying \”I want more customers,\” aim for \”I want to generate 50 qualified leads per month through contact form submissions.\”
Consider both short-term and long-term objectives. Your initial website might focus on establishing credibility and capturing leads, while your long-term vision might include e-commerce functionality, customer portals, or integration with business systems.
Know Your Target Audience
Understanding who will use your website is crucial for creating an effective user experience. Develop detailed profiles of your ideal customers, including their demographics, pain points, online behavior, and what information they’re seeking when they visit your site.
Ask yourself: What devices do they primarily use? Are they tech-savvy or do they prefer simple navigation? What questions do they need answered before making a purchase decision? This insight will guide design decisions, content strategy, and functionality priorities.
Gather Your Content and Assets
One of the most common causes of project delays is waiting for content. Before starting your website development project, begin collecting and organizing all the materials you’ll need:
- Written content: Company descriptions, service or product details, team bios, and any other text that will appear on your site
- Images: High-quality photos of your products, team, office, or relevant stock imagery
- Brand assets: Your logo in various formats, brand guidelines, color codes, and fonts
- Legal documents: Privacy policies, terms of service, and any compliance-related content
- Existing materials: Brochures, presentations, or marketing materials that can be repurposed
If you don’t have professional content ready, consider whether you’ll need to hire a copywriter or photographer. Quality content is just as important as quality design and development.
Set a Realistic Budget and Timeline
Website development costs can vary dramatically based on complexity, features, and customization level. Research what similar businesses in your industry have invested in their websites to establish realistic expectations.
Your budget should account for more than just the initial development. Consider ongoing costs like hosting, domain registration, SSL certificates, premium plugins or themes, and regular updates. Being transparent about your budget with potential developers helps them propose solutions that fit your financial parameters.
Similarly, understand that quality web development takes time. A simple business website might take 4-6 weeks, while complex e-commerce or custom applications could require several months. Rushing the process often leads to compromises in quality or functionality.
Choose the Right Development Partner
Selecting who will build your website is one of your most important decisions. Look beyond just price and consider factors like:
- Relevant experience in your industry or with similar projects
- Portfolio quality and client testimonials
- Communication style and responsiveness
- Technical expertise in the platforms and technologies you need
- Understanding of SEO and digital marketing principles
- Post-launch support and training offerings
When working with a professional web developer, you’re not just buying a website—you’re forming a partnership. Choose someone who asks thoughtful questions, offers strategic insights, and demonstrates genuine interest in your business success.
Plan for Ongoing Maintenance and Growth
Your website launch is just the beginning. Websites require regular maintenance to stay secure, perform well, and remain effective. Before your site goes live, establish a plan for ongoing updates, security monitoring, content additions, and technical support.
Many businesses underestimate the importance of website maintenance and management, only to face security vulnerabilities, broken functionality, or outdated content down the line. Factor this into your planning from the start, whether you’ll handle it in-house or partner with a professional service.
Also consider how your website will evolve. While you don’t need every feature on day one, understanding your growth trajectory helps developers build a scalable foundation that can accommodate future enhancements without requiring a complete rebuild.
Conclusion
Proper preparation is your secret weapon for a successful website development project. By clearly defining your goals, understanding your audience, gathering necessary materials, setting realistic expectations, choosing the right development partner, and planning for ongoing maintenance, you set the stage for a website that truly serves your business needs.
Remember that website development is an investment in your business’s digital future. The time you spend preparing on the front end will pay dividends in smoother execution, better results, and a final product that effectively supports your business objectives for years to come.







